The Best Robot Vacuum and Mop For Pet Hair
The best robot vacuum and mop for dog hair robot vacuum is vital for pet owners with dogs and cats. Choose a model that can collect pet hair without getting stuck on it.
Also, think about how big a dustbin it has and whether or not it's self-emptying. Larger bins allow you to clean more often before having to empty them.
1. Roomba j7+ from iRobot
The j7+ is iRobot's newest and smartest robot vacuum and mop combo. It is a well-built robot that has a variety of advanced automation features. Its most distinctive feature is Hazard detection feature, which allows it to recognize and avoid obstacles such as pet waste, socks, cords furniture legs, and so on in real-time.
It's compatible with Alexa and Google Assistant, and can be controlled completely via the iRobot Genius app. It also has an automatic dust bin that can be empty and a clean base which makes it a great choice for anyone with pets or kids. It's great at picking up debris from floors that are bare and carpets with low pile, however, it has issues with high pile. It also comes with an edge-sweeping and dual multi-surface rubber brushes to provide thorough cleaning. Its iAdapt Navigation System maps out your house to ensure that it is properly cleaned every time.
2. IRobot Roomba i7
The Roomba i7 revolutionized robot vacuuming and is still at the forefront of technology, offering self-emptying tech for weeks of hands-free cleaning, and granular mapping that can detect the legs of chairs and other furniture. It is able to clean a room faster than its competitors and performs better on low-pile flooring.
The i7 is more durable and is easier to maintain than the i4. It has a bigger dirt compartment and can automatically empty itself using docking stations. It also consumes less energy, incurs fewer recurring costs and has a longer battery life.
The i7 is compatible with a smart hub, and can be controlled by an app that will learn the frequency at which you're likely vacuum and can offer personalised schedules. It's also compatible with Alexa and Google Home. The i7 is the ideal robot vacuum for cleaning pet hair off plain floors, however it has a difficult time dealing with grit and larger particles like rice.
